Output 43341cd0ca387ab8577fd280401c9814fbb2066c069f0c9ba923b51a16aa59a9:2

value
535907
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bfe46a61a7b5823e01fe5009d9b152d30f46c41 OP_EQUALVERIFY OP_CHECKSIG
address
1DmDY4z6Pnjw8hi9niw6myQps8kQMrPknq
transaction
43341cd0ca387ab8577fd280401c9814fbb2066c069f0c9ba923b51a16aa59a9
spent
true